2-(4-ethoxyphenyl)acetyl chloride

Base Information Edit
  • Chemical Name:2-(4-ethoxyphenyl)acetyl chloride
  • CAS No.:10368-35-1
  • Molecular Formula:C10H11ClO2
  • Molecular Weight:198.649
  • Hs Code.:
  • Mol file:10368-35-1.mol
2-(4-ethoxyphenyl)acetyl chloride

Synonyms:4-ethoxyphenylacetic acid chloride

Technology Process of 2-(4-ethoxyphenyl)acetyl chloride

There total 4 articles about 2-(4-ethoxyphenyl)acetyl chloride which guide to synthetic route it. synthetic route:
Guidance literature:
With thionyl chloride; N,N-dimethyl-formamide; In dichloromethane; for 2h; Reflux;
Guidance literature:
Multi-step reaction with 2 steps
1: sodium hydroxide; methanol / 3 h / 20 °C
2: thionyl chloride / chloroform; N,N-dimethyl-formamide / 75 °C / Inert atmosphere
With methanol; thionyl chloride; sodium hydroxide; In chloroform; N,N-dimethyl-formamide;
Guidance literature:
Multi-step reaction with 3 steps
1.1: potassium carbonate / acetonitrile / 0.5 h / 65 °C / Inert atmosphere
1.2: 80 °C / Inert atmosphere
2.1: sodium hydroxide; methanol / 3 h / 20 °C
3.1: thionyl chloride / chloroform; N,N-dimethyl-formamide / 75 °C / Inert atmosphere
With methanol; thionyl chloride; potassium carbonate; sodium hydroxide; In chloroform; N,N-dimethyl-formamide; acetonitrile;
